X-Git-Url: http://info.iut-bm.univ-fcomte.fr/pub/gitweb/simgrid.git/blobdiff_plain/3a1ea70a418f393ca1677074e928c664022295bd..75c3f46b3bffec7d7d6e5162146211ad430767bc:/src/surf/StorageImpl.hpp?ds=sidebyside diff --git a/src/surf/StorageImpl.hpp b/src/surf/StorageImpl.hpp index 72e3092676..158e5e82a2 100644 --- a/src/surf/StorageImpl.hpp +++ b/src/surf/StorageImpl.hpp @@ -62,7 +62,7 @@ public: */ class StorageImpl : public Resource, public xbt::PropertyHolder { s4u::Storage piface_; - lmm::Constraint* constraint_read_; /* Constraint for maximum write bandwidth*/ + lmm::Constraint* constraint_read_; /* Constraint for maximum read bandwidth*/ lmm::Constraint* constraint_write_; /* Constraint for maximum write bandwidth*/ std::string typeId_; @@ -82,12 +82,13 @@ public: ~StorageImpl() override; + const s4u::Storage* get_iface() const { return &piface_; } s4u::Storage* get_iface() { return &piface_; } const char* get_type() const { return typeId_.c_str(); } lmm::Constraint* get_read_constraint() const { return constraint_read_; } lmm::Constraint* get_write_constraint() const { return constraint_write_; } /** @brief Check if the Storage is used (if an action currently uses its resources) */ - bool is_used() override; + bool is_used() const override; void apply_event(profile::Event* event, double value) override;